Elizabeth "Betty" Jean Haley passed away at Sundance Inn, New Braunfels, TX at the age of 88 Years on March 4, 2012. Life began for Betty when she was born to Thomas F. Haley and Myrtle Allen Haley in El Reno, OK. She grew up in El Reno with her four siblings: Mary Claire, Clarence, Ruth and Frank. She was a talented opera singer who first shared her beautiful voice on her own radio show aired from El Paso, TX during WWII. She left El Paso to further her education in singing at Columbia University in New York. After spending her working life in New York, which included 20 years of service with both AT&T and Revlon, Betty relocated to New Braunfels. Betty was a member of St. Peter and Paul Church. Betty is survived by her niece, Pat Stover (New Braunfels); nephews: Robert Haley (Geary, OK) and Pat Haley (Houston, TX); grandnieces: Theresa Brown (Sonoma, CA), Suzanne Stover (New Braunfels), Carla Quinn (Austin, TX) and Tamara Keese (Vernon, TX); grandnephew: Richard Stover, Jr. A private memorial will be held for the family at the Comal Cemetery in New Braunfels where she will be interred by her sister, Mary Claire Dennis.
